Society
Tumblr media
Summary: Upper-class high schooler Bill (Billy Warlock) suspects that his parents are part of an elite cult.
Cult (so to speak) horror comedy best known for its penultimate scene for good reason. Build-up is pretty good too.
Rating: 3.5/5

Society is a 1989 American body horror film directed by Brian Yuzna and starring Billy Warlock, Devin DeVasquez, Evan Richards, and Ben Meyerson. Its plot follows a Beverly Hills teenager who begins to suspect that his wealthy parents are part of a gruesome cult for the social elite.
Though the film was completed in 1989, it was not released until 1992. It was Yuzna's directorial debut and was written by Rick Fry, conceived and written by Woody Keith. Screaming Mad George was responsible for the special effects. A sequel, Society 2: Body Modification, was in development as of 2013, with a script written by Stephan Biro. - Wikipedia.
